Once you have applied, the Admissions Board will assess whether you have any deficiencies and which additional courses you need to take to address them. You may have a maximum of 60 ECTS in deficiencies to be eligible for a bridging programme (pre-Master's programme).
Upon successful completion of your pre-Master’s programme and provided you have met all other admission requirements, you will receive an email confirming your unconditional admission to the associated Master’s programme. You will not receive a Bachelor’s degree.

A pre-Master’s programme cannot contain more than 60 credits. If you have a greater deficiency, you are required to follow a second Bachelor's programme in order to be admitted to the Master's programme. You may in some cases be granted exemptions for parts of this second Bachelor's programme, depending on your prior education.
The tuition fees for your pre-Master’s programme depend on the number of credits (ECTS) you need to obtain. If you also follow courses outside the pre-Master’s programme in question, you will be required to pay the full institutional tuition fee.
Restitution is not possible for pre-Master's programmes.

In order to study in the Netherlands, you may need to apply for a residence permit (VVR) and/or an entry visa (MVV). The UvA is not allowed to apply for a residence permit on your behalf solely for a pre-masters programme. A residence permit application is only possible if your pre-master programme grants direct admission to the accompanying master’s programme and if you start the master’s immediately after your pre-master’s. Each pre-master programme indicates whether it is possible to apply if you require a residence permit.
